Nike Keeper Gloves Buying Guide

Glove Cut

What it is: The cut of a goalkeeper glove refers to how the palm is attached to the backhand. Different cuts offer varying levels of fit, ball contact, and comfort. Choices include flat cut, roll finger, negative cut, and hybrid cuts. Each cut has unique characteristics suited to different playing styles and preferences. Understanding these differences is crucial for optimal performance.

Why it matters: The glove cut significantly impacts your ability to catch, hold, and distribute the ball. It affects the feel of the ball in your hands and the overall comfort of the glove. A suitable cut maximizes grip and control, allowing for confident saves and accurate throws. An unsuitable cut can hinder performance and lead to discomfort.

What specs to look for: Consider the level of ball feel you prefer. Flat cuts offer a traditional feel, while roll finger cuts provide a snug fit. Negative cuts offer a tight fit with enhanced ball feel. Hybrid cuts combine various features. Think about your preferred playing style and the fit you desire.

Palm Material

What it is: The palm material is the primary surface that contacts the ball. Latex is the most common material, but its quality varies. Different latex formulas provide different levels of grip, durability, and performance in various weather conditions. Some gloves use other materials or combinations for specific benefits.

Why it matters: The palm material directly affects your grip on the ball, especially in wet conditions. It also impacts the glove’s durability and overall feel. A high-quality palm offers superior grip, allowing you to confidently catch and hold the ball. The material’s durability determines how long the glove will last.

What specs to look for: Look for high-quality latex, such as contact foam or super soft latex, for excellent grip. Consider the glove’s intended use and the playing conditions. Some gloves are designed for wet weather, while others prioritize durability. Check the thickness of the palm, which can affect cushioning and ball feel.

Backhand Material

What it is: The backhand is the material on the back of the glove. This area often includes padding and protective elements. Materials vary, ranging from breathable mesh to more robust synthetic fabrics. The backhand is essential for providing support and protection to the hand.

Why it matters: The backhand material influences the glove’s overall comfort, breathability, and protection. It shields your hand from impacts and allows for effective punching and deflecting. A well-designed backhand helps prevent injuries and enhances performance.

What specs to look for: Consider the level of protection you need. Some backhands feature thicker padding for impact resistance. Breathability is also crucial, especially in warmer weather. Look for materials that offer a good balance of protection, comfort, and flexibility. Consider the type of stitching used.

Closure System

What it is: The closure system secures the glove around your wrist. Common options include wrist straps, elastic bandages, and slip-on designs. The closure system ensures a secure and comfortable fit, preventing the glove from slipping during play. It also provides wrist support.

Why it matters: A secure closure system is critical for preventing the glove from shifting during saves and throws. It also provides wrist support, reducing the risk of injury. A well-designed closure system allows for a personalized fit, enhancing comfort and performance.

What specs to look for: Look for a closure system that offers a secure and adjustable fit. Consider the width and length of the strap, as well as the type of fastening mechanism. Some gloves feature a double-wrap wrist strap for added support. The closure system should feel comfortable.

Finger Protection

What it is: Some goalkeeper gloves incorporate finger protection, also known as finger spines or finger saves. These are usually plastic or flexible stays inserted into the backhand. They help to prevent the fingers from bending backward during saves, reducing the risk of injury.

Why it matters: Finger protection is important for goalkeepers who are prone to finger injuries. It can significantly reduce the risk of hyperextension and other finger-related problems. However, it can also impact the flexibility and feel of the glove.

What specs to look for: Consider whether you need finger protection based on your playing style and injury history. Look for gloves with removable finger spines if you want flexibility. Ensure the finger protection doesn’t hinder your ability to catch and handle the ball. The protection should fit well.

Sizing and Fit

What it is: Proper sizing is essential for optimal performance and comfort. Goalkeeper gloves are measured based on the length of your hand from the base of your palm to the tip of your middle finger. A good fit allows for a balance of comfort, grip, and control.

Why it matters: A glove that is too small will be restrictive, while one that is too large can impair your ability to catch and control the ball. A properly sized glove will fit snugly without being too tight, allowing for full range of motion. It also enhances the feel of the ball.

What specs to look for: Measure your hand carefully and consult the manufacturer’s size chart. Try on gloves to ensure a comfortable and secure fit. Consider the cut of the glove, as different cuts may fit differently. The glove should feel snug without restricting your movement. Try to test different sizes. Frequently Asked Questions

What Is the Best Nike Glove for Beginners?

The Nike Match Goalkeeper Gloves are a great starting point. They offer good grip and durability.

They are also generally affordable.

How Do I Measure My Hand for Nike Goalkeeper Gloves?

Measure from the base of your palm to the tip of your middle finger. Consult the Nike size chart.

This will help you find the right size.

What Is the Difference Between Nike’s Different Palm Materials?

Nike uses various latex foams. Each foam provides a different grip. The more expensive ones tend to grip better.

Some are designed for dry or wet conditions.

How Do I Clean My Nike Goalkeeper Gloves?

Rinse your gloves with lukewarm water after each use. Gently rub off any dirt.

Air dry them away from direct sunlight.

How Long Do Nike Goalkeeper Gloves Last?

The lifespan depends on usage and care. Typically, they last for a season or two.

Proper care will extend their life.

Can I Use Nike Goalkeeper Gloves on Artificial Turf?

Yes, but the surface can wear down the palms faster. Choose gloves with durable palms.

Consider using a specific artificial turf glove.

What Is the Benefit of Finger Protection in Nike Gloves?

Finger protection helps prevent hyperextension. It reduces the risk of finger injuries.

It is especially useful for powerful shots.
